The requirements of the second generation standard, an exemplary program of primary general education and the main provisions of the Concept of the content of education of schoolchildren in the field of physical culture (A.P. Matveev, 2001). When creating the program, the needs of modern Russian society in a physically strong and capable younger generation, able to actively engage in a variety of forms healthy lifestyle life, to use the values ​​of physical culture for self-education, self-development and self-realization. The program reflects the objectively established realities of the modern socio-cultural development of society, the conditions for the activities of educational institutions, the requirements of teachers and methodologists on the need to update the content of education, the introduction of new methods and technologies in the educational process.

Aim curriculum in physical culture is the formation of students elementary school the foundations of a healthy lifestyle, the development of interest and creative independence in conducting various forms of physical education. The implementation of this goal is ensured by the content of the subject of the discipline " Physical Culture”, which is the physical (motor) activity of a person, focused on strengthening and maintaining health, developing physical qualities and abilities, acquiring certain knowledge, motor skills and abilities.

The implementation of the goal of the curriculum correlates with the solution of the following educational tasks:

- strengthening the health of schoolchildren through the development of physical qualities and increasing the functionality of life-supporting body systems;

- improving vital skills and abilities through teaching outdoor games, physical exercises and technical actions from basic sports;

– formation of general ideas about physical culture, its significance in human life, its role in health promotion, physical development and physical fitness;

– development of interest in independent physical exercises, outdoor games, forms active rest and leisure;

- teaching the simplest ways to control physical activity, individual indicators of physical development and physical fitness.

The basic result of education in the field of physical culture in primary school is the development by students of the basics of physical education with a general developmental focus. Mastering the subject of this activity contributes not only to the active development of the physical nature of those involved, but also to the formation of their mental and social qualities of the individual, which largely determine the formation and subsequent formation of the universal abilities (competences) of a person. The universality of competencies is determined, first of all, by their wide demand by each person, by an objective necessity for performing various types of activities that go beyond the scope of physical education.

The number of universal competencies that are formed in elementary school in the process of mastering the subject of physical activity with a general developmental orientation by students includes:

- the ability to organize one's own activity, to choose and use means to achieve its goal;

- the ability to actively engage in collective activity, interact with peers in achieving common goals;

- the ability to convey information in an accessible, emotionally vivid form in the process of communication and interaction with peers and adults.
The place of the subject in the curriculum

Working program of the main primary education in physical culture is compiled in accordance with the number of hours specified in the Basic plan of educational institutions of general education. The subject "Physical Education" is studied in elementary school for at least 405 hours, of which in grade I - 99 hours, and from grades II to IV - 102 hours annually.

Physical culture (basic concepts). Physical culture and health-improving direction as the most massive direction associated with the strengthening and preservation of health, the organization of active recreation and leisure. Its purpose, objectives, main content.

Forms of occupations by improving physical culture. Their place and time in the mode of the school day and school week.

Sports direction as a direction associated with the preparation of a person for competitive activity. Its purpose, objectives, main content. competitive action.

Physical training as a training process for the development of physical qualities, providing high sports achievements in the chosen sport.

Types of physical training (general physical training, technical training, special physical training).

Applied direction of physical culture as a direction associated with the preparation of a person for the upcoming activity, including the development of professional activity. Its purpose, objectives, main content. The main forms of applied physical culture classes. Their content and focus

Harmonious physical development. Ideas of harmonious development among different peoples. The variability of these ideas in different historical eras. Coefficient of harmony. Determination of the harmony of one's own physique. Standard indicators of a harmonious physique

Sports training as a unity of physical, technical and psychological training of an athlete. Its purpose and content

Adaptive physical education as a means of active inclusion in the public life of people with disabilities. Its role and significance both for people with disabilities themselves and for society as a whole. Therapeutic physical culture as an effective tool that accelerates the treatment of chronic diseases, the restoration of body functions after illnesses, surgeries and injuries.

Its role and importance in life modern man

Physical culture of a person. Posture correction as a purposeful process of bringing its shape in line with established standards. Types of posture disorders. The main signs of posture disorders and their causes. Genetic conditionality of body type. The possibility of its correction in physical education classes.

Body like external form human body, depending on the ratio of the height and weight indicators of its main parts.

Parameters of the main parts of the body in the adolescent period of development with an optimal physique and methods for measuring them.

Safety requirements for classes held at home.

Massage and its history. The connection of massage with strengthening health, with the restoration of the body after hard mental and physical work. Modern views massages and their purpose. Hygienic rules for massage procedures. Characteristics of the main methods of restorative massage

Evaluation of the effectiveness of the process of physical education is carried out on the basis of identifying assessments of the physical fitness of students, technical fitness of students, theoretical preparedness.

When grading, the following requirements are met:

An individual approach, when each student is given the opportunity to prove himself in conditions that best suit the characteristics of his physical development, physical fitness, and health status;

The specificity of the criteria, when the current assessment correlates with a clearly formulated task set by the student;

Publicity of the assessment, when the student is informed about the assessment in a timely manner and a brief explanation of it is given.

The work program includes the following types of control:

Preliminary control is carried out to determine the ability of students to master physical exercises and fulfill the standards of the curriculum.

Operational control (during the lesson) allows you to evaluate any components of the program material (homework, oral answer, warm-up, the quality of the performance of motor actions or their elements, victory in an educational game or relay race, etc.) for the operational management of students' activities at each lesson.

Current control(according to the results of several lessons) involves a control to determine the effectiveness of mastering the topic being studied (for example, a long jump from a run for a result, a 60-meter run for a result, etc.).

Staged control– state control over a relatively long period of time, reveals the main trends in the process of physical education at its relatively long stages (quarter, trimester, half a year).

Final control used to determine the final results for the year. Allows you to evaluate the current system of lessons, compare the results with the planned ones and obtain data for adjusting the planning of the physical education process for the next academic year.

Knowledge about physical culture (1 section)

Assessing the knowledge of students, they take into account their depth and completeness, the argumentation of the presentation, the ability to use knowledge in relation to specific cases and practical exercises.

The mark "5" is given for the answer, in which the student demonstrates a deep understanding of the essence of the material, logically presents it, using examples from practice, his own experience.

A score of "4" is given for an answer that contains small inaccuracies and minor errors.

Grade "3" students receive for the answer, which lacks a logical sequence, there are gaps in the material, there is no proper argumentation and the ability to use knowledge in their experience.

Grade "2" - poor understanding and knowledge of theoretical and methodological material.

The following can be used to assess knowledge. methods:

Poll method is used orally and in writing in the pauses between the exercises, before and after the tasks. It is not recommended to use this method after significant physical exertion.

Programmed Method is that students receive cards with questions and a fan of answers to them. The student must choose the correct answer. The method is economical to conduct and allows the survey to be carried out frontally.

Very effective method knowledge test is demonstration of knowledge students in specific activities. For example, the presentation of knowledge of exercises for the development of strength, students accompany the implementation of a specific complex, etc.

Methods of motor (physical culture) activity (section 2)

Score "5" - the student demonstrates a complete and varied set of exercises aimed at developing a specific physical (motor) ability, or a set of exercises for morning, athletic or rhythmic gymnastics, can independently organize the place of the lesson, pick up equipment and apply it in specific conditions, control the course assignments and evaluate them.

Score "4" - there are minor errors or inaccuracies in the implementation of independent sports and recreational activities.

Grade "3" - makes gross mistakes in the selection and demonstration of exercises aimed at developing a specific physical (motor) ability. Experiencing difficulties in organizing places of employment, selection of inventory. Satisfactorily controls the progress and results of the task.

Grade "2" - the student does not have the ability to exercise different kinds physical culture and health-improving activities.

Technique of possession of motor actions (skills, skills) (section 3)

Score "5" - the motor action was performed correctly (in a given way), exactly at the proper pace, easily and clearly.

Score "4" - the motor action was performed correctly, but not easily and clearly enough, there is some stiffness of movements.

Score "3" - the motor action was performed mostly correctly, but one gross or several minor errors were made, which led to uncertain or tense performance.

Score "2" - the motor action was performed incorrectly, with gross errors, uncertainly, indistinctly.

Main methods motor actions possession technique assessments are observation, challenge, exercises and combined methods.

open observation method is that students know whom and what the teacher will evaluate. Covert observation is that students know only that the teacher will observe certain types of motor actions.

Call as an assessment method is used to identify the achievements of individual students in mastering the program material and to demonstrate to the class samples of the correct execution of a motor action.

Exercise method is designed to test the level of proficiency in individual skills and abilities, the quality of homework.

essence combined method consists in the fact that the teacher, simultaneously with the knowledge test, evaluates the quality of mastering the technique of the corresponding motor actions.

These methods can be applied both individually and frontally, when a large group or class as a whole is evaluated at the same time.
